Traumatic Brain Injury is Much Bigger than a Sports “Concussion Crisis” Authors Kathryn Henne and Matt Ventresca explain the larger story of inequality behind today's concussion crisis—and why many more people experience brain injury without the same attention afforded at...

@ucpress.bsky.social has featured an editorial about my new book with Matt Ventresca. The piece, Traumatic Brain Injury is Much Bigger than a Sports “Concussion Crisis”, provides an overview of the issues we cover in Violent Impacts.

A rich L.A. neighborhood donated surveillance technology to the LAPD — then drama ensued Some police officials are pushing back after a wealthy community gifted the department scores of controversial, high-tech cameras that scan license plates.

Who could have guessed that when a rich neighborhood association donated $200,000 worth of automated license plate readers to the police foundation that they’d also want to dictate how the cameras are used.
